Looking for reliable tires for your 2007 Dodge Durango? You’ve come to the right place. The 2007 Dodge Durango typically uses tire sizes like 265/70-17 and 265/65-17, among others, depending on the trim and wheel package. Choosing the right tires ensures optimal safety, handling, and comfort on the road. Be sure to check your owner's manual or the tire placard on your vehicle for exact size recommendations.

Essential Tire Maintenance Tips

  • Regularly check tire pressure to enhance fuel efficiency and tire life.
  • Rotate tires every 5,000 to 7,000 miles for even wear.
  • Inspect tread depth and replace tires before they become unsafe.
  • Balance and align tires when installing new sets or if you notice uneven wear.

The 2007 Dodge Durango commonly uses tire sizes such as 265/70-17 and 265/65-17, depending on the model and trim. Always verify your specific vehicle’s tire size on the tire placard or owner's manual to ensure compatibility.

While you can replace a single tire on your 2007 Dodge Durango, it's generally recommended to replace tires in pairs or all four, especially for AWD or 4WD models. Yes, all-season tires are a practical choice for many 2007 Dodge Durango owners, providing reliable traction in wet, dry, and light winter conditions. However, if you face heavy snow or rugged terrain, specialized winter or all-terrain tires might be more suitable.
